The owl motif has been popular in jewelry for centuries, often symbolizing wisdom, mystery, and protection. In the mid-20th century, particularly during the 1970s and 1980s, whimsical animal designs like articulated owls became very fashionable, often made from base metals and featuring colorful stones or glass for eyes.
Articulated jewelry, where parts of the piece can move, adds an element of playfulness and visual interest. The use of red cabochons for the owl's eyes is a common characteristic of this era's costume jewelry, designed to be eye-catching.
